高光譜成像的趨勢和預測

預計到2030年,全球高光譜成像市場將達到 27 億美元,2024年至2030年年複合成長率為 16.7%。該市場的主要驅動力是硬體和軟體進步創新的資金和投資的增加、工業應用中高光譜成像利用率的提高、國防/國防安全保障業務和商業應用中的遠端控制。對感測資料的需求不斷增加。全球高光譜成像市場的未來前景廣闊,軍事監控、遙感、生命科學和醫療診斷、機器視覺和光學分選市場都有機會。

高光譜成像市場洞察

Lucintel 預測,由於高速、低成本電路、先進製造技術以及感測器開發中的新訊號處理技術,相機將在預測期內實現最高成長。

在這個市場中,由於用於監視和資訊收集的高光譜相機的國防和國防安全保障應用不斷擴大,軍事監視仍然是最大的區隔。

由於政府對衛星發射的投資增加以及國防應用中成像相機的採用增加,北美在預測期內仍將是最大的地區。

Hyperspectral Imaging Trends and Forecast

The future of the global hyperspectral imaging market looks promising with opportunities in the military surveillance, remote sensing, life sciences & medical diagnostic, and machine vision & optical sorting markets. The global hyperspectral imaging market is expected to reach an estimated $2.7 billion by 2030 with a CAGR of 16.7% from 2024 to 2030. The major drivers for this market are growing funding and investments for innovation in hardware and software advancement, rising usage of of hyperspectral imaging in industrial applications, and rising requirement for remote sensing data in defense/homeland security operations and commercial applications.

Hyperspectral Imaging Market Insights

Lucintel forecasts that camera is expected to witness highest growth over the forecast period owing to its high-speed and low-cost circuits, advanced manufacturing technologies, and novel signal-processing methods in sensor development.

Within this market, military surveillance will remain the largest segment due to the growing application of hyperspectral cameras in the defense and homeland security for surveillance and collection of airborne intelligence.

North America will remain the largest region over the forecast period due to growing investments of government in satellite launches and increasing adoption of imaging cameras in defense applications.
